XSORIES Kong U-Shot Aluminum Monopod |
The Kong U-Shot Aluminum Monopod from XSories weighs just 1.4 lb, extends from 26.4 to 61.0", and can support gear weighing 7.7 lb or less. It is waterproof, and features twist locks to extend and secure the leg sections, as well as a 1/4"-20 threaded stud to attach a camera or a head. Hi Rise Camera Telescopic Pole |
The carbon fiber constructed Telescopic Pole from Hi Rise Camera can be used either as a spare or replacement part. It is compatible with a tripod base that is part of the HI Rise Camera tripod system. Each one of the four sections stay in place with aluminum clamping locks.
